Professionally Aligned Computer Science Homework Help with UK Rubrics — an accurate assistance to boost scores
Getting high-quality computer science coursework help requires more than just a passing knowledge of code; it demands a deep alignment with the rigorous academic standards of UK universities. When you seek a computer science helper for your projects, the focus is often on meeting specific UK rubrics, which prioritize critical analysis, technical accuracy, and professional documentation over simple completion.
Understanding UK University Rubrics
In the UK, computer science assignments are typically graded against a specific set of criteria. Services like MyAssignmentHelp align their assistance with these categories, giving a guarantee to ensure students hit the "First-Class" (70%+).
| Criterion |
What UK Computer Science Professionals Look For |
How Help Services Align |
| Technical Proficiency |
Bug-free code, efficient algorithms, and use of industry-standard frameworks. |
Implementation of clean code principles and robust testing (Unit/Integration tests). |
| Critical Evaluation |
Discussion of why a specific data structure or design pattern was chosen. |
Including a detailed "Rationale" section in the technical report. Our database assistance guide helps to develop crystal clear data to get desirable results. |
| Academic Integrity |
Zero plagiarism and correct referencing (Harvard or IEEE styles). |
Provision of plagiarism reports and meticulous citation of external libraries. |
| Documentation |
Clear variable naming, comments, and comprehensive README files or reports. |
Professional formatting of technical reports and system architecture diagrams. |
Comprehensive Computer Science Project Help
Whether you are a first-year student or a final-year postgraduate, a computer science project helps cover a vast spectrum of specialized areas. Professional assistance ensures that complex theoretical concepts are translated into working, real-world solutions.
- Software Engineering & SDLC: Support for the entire lifecycle, from requirement analysis using MoSCoW prioritization to Agile project management and deployment.
- Database Management: We help with computer science assignments for designing normalized relational databases (SQL) or scalable NoSQL architectures, ensuring data integrity and security.
- AI and Machine Learning: Assistance with data preprocessing, model selection (e.g., Random Forest, CNNs), and performance evaluation using Confusion Matrices and F1-scores.
- Cybersecurity: Guidance on network security, encryption protocols, and ethical hacking reports aligned with UK legal frameworks like the Computer Misuse Act.
- Support for Web Development: From front-end design to back-end logic, our Web Development support covers HTML, CSS, JavaScript, and frameworks, helping you build robust and responsive web projects.
Beyond these core areas, our service supports an extensive array of specialized topics, ranging from Java to MATLAB assignment help and also includes data management and core programming. Each professional on our team possesses the deep technical expertise required to master diverse project requirements. By applying their high-level industry knowledge, our experts ensure every paper is executed to perfection, meeting the rigorous standards of UK universities.
How to Get Help With Your Computer Science Assignment
If you are struggling with a "write my assignment" moment, the process of getting computer science homework help is streamlined for the fast-paced UK academic calendar:
- Requirement Submission: Upload your brief, including the specific UK university rubric and any starter code provided.
- Expert Allocation: Your task is assigned to a specialist with a PhD or a Master’s in Computer Science who understands the specific module requirements.
- Quality Assurance: The work undergoes a multi-stage check, ensuring it is 100% original and follows the requested coding standards (PEP 8 for Python, Google Java Style, etc.).
- Delivery & Revision: You receive your solution well before the deadline, with the option for unlimited revisions if any part of the rubric wasn't perfectly addressed.
By leveraging expert computer science coursework help, you don't just "get the work done"—you gain a reference model that enhances your own understanding of complex computing systems.
Comprehensive languages that are used to write a Computer Science assignment
Choosing the right programming language is less about "which one is best" and more about "which tool fits the job." In computer science, languages are categorized by their abstraction level—how close they are to human logic versus machine hardware—and their specific use cases.
Here is a breakdown of the primary languages used in the field today to help with your assignment.
Low-Level Languages: Hardware and Performance
Low-level languages like C and C++ provide immense power because they allow direct manipulation of a computer's memory and hardware. Because of their complexity, students often seek C++ assignment help to master concepts like pointers and memory management.
C: The foundation of modern operating systems and embedded systems.
C++: The gold standard for high-performance applications, such as AAA video games and high-frequency trading platforms.
High-Level Languages: Human-Centric Logic
These languages prioritize readability and developer speed. They handle memory management automatically, making them ideal for rapid software production.
Python: The king of versatility. It is the primary tool for Artificial Intelligence (AI) and data science. For those struggling with script syntax, Python assignment help can bridge the gap between theory and execution.
Java: Built on the "Write Once, Run Anywhere" philosophy, it remains the backbone of enterprise-level corporate systems.
Web Development and Data Management
The modern web relies on a "stack" of languages that manage how information is displayed and stored.
HTML/CSS: The structural and aesthetic building blocks of every webpage.
JavaScript: The logic of the web, enabling interactive elements like live maps and real-time updates.
SQL (Structured Query Language): The universal language for communicating with databases. Students managing large datasets often utilize SQL assignment help to refine their query optimization skills.
Machine Learning Integration: Modern web platforms increasingly incorporate Machine Learning to personalize user experiences and automate data analysis. By leveraging Python-based frameworks, our experts integrate predictive models and pattern recognition directly into web applications. This intersection of data science and development is a primary focus for students seeking advanced Machine Learning assistance.
Software Engineering: Our computer science assignment helper offers the best assistance for crafting a project related to the application of CS in software engineering. Software engineering applies structured design and engineering principles to the theoretical foundations of computer science. While computer science focuses on algorithms and computational theory, software engineering transforms these concepts into functional, scalable applications. By using systematic lifecycles and rigorous testing, it ensures that abstract code becomes reliable, high-performance software capable of solving real-world problems in diverse digital environments.
Specialized Programming Paradigms
Modern development often requires languages designed for specific platforms or safety standards. Our specialized Programming Assignment UK assistance helps to give reliable solutions to boost scores in the exam.
Swift/Kotlin: The standards for iOS and Android development.
R: Specifically built for heavy statistical analysis and data visualization.
Rust: Known for "memory safety," preventing common bugs found in older languages.
Quick comparison between Python and Java in Computer science
| Feature |
Python |
Java |
| Syntax |
Concise and human-readable. |
Verbose and highly structured. |
| Typing |
Dynamically Typed: Determined at runtime. |
Statically Typed: Explicitly declared. |
| Compilation |
Interpreted: Executed line-by-line. |
Compiled: Bytecode for the JVM. |
| Performance |
Generally slower. |
Faster due to JIT compilation. |
| Memory |
Automatic (Garbage Collection). |
Automatic (Garbage Collection). |
Navigating various programming languages is a core challenge for students today. MyAssignmentHelp provides comprehensive computer science assignment assistance to bridge the gap between academic theory and practical coding. The platform offers targeted coding assignment help in computer science across multiple paradigms, ensuring students master both syntax and logic.
Why do students face challenges in crafting the best quality Computer science assignments?
Succeeding in a computer science degree within the United Kingdom involves meeting the exceptionally high standards of the British higher education system. Students often encounter specific obstacles that go beyond simple coding, requiring a blend of technical mastery and academic precision.
Here are the primary pain points for students seeking computer science assignment help online in the UK.
Strict Academic Integrity and AI Oversight
UK universities, especially Russell Group institutions, uphold some of the most stringent plagiarism policies in the world.
Originality issues: Students must ensure that both their source code and technical documentation pass sophisticated similarity checks.
Insightful Thought: With the rise of generative AI, institutions have implemented advanced detection methods to ensure students are developing their own logical frameworks rather than relying on automated scripts.
Mastery of Complex Referencing Standards
In the UK, referencing is not just for the humanities; it is a critical component of technical submissions.
Dual Standards: Students often struggle to balance the Harvard Referencing System for reflective essays with IEEE standards for technical reports.
Formatting Precision: Even minor errors in a bibliography can lead to significant grade deductions. Many students utilize Computer Science Assignment Help to ensure their citations meet these exacting university rubrics.
High Mathematical and Theoretical Thresholds
The UK curriculum is deeply rooted in the mathematical foundations of computation, which can be a difficult transition for those who prefer pure coding.
| Subject Area |
Primary Challenge |
| Discrete Mathematics |
Managing set theory, logic, and graph theory. |
| Algorithm Analysis |
Master of Big O notation and time complexity proofs. |
| Computational Theory |
Understanding the mathematical limits of solvability. |
The Burden of Documentation
A common hurdle is the requirement to explain the "why" behind the "how." In the UK, a 100-line script often requires a 1,000-word report.
Reflective Writing: Assignments often demand a deep dive into the choice of data structures and a critical evaluation of the testing strategy.
Readability Standards: Maintaining a professional tone while ensuring the report meets accessibility standards is a frequent struggle for international and domestic students alike.
Regional Competition for Expert Support
Finding a computer science solver who understands the localized nuances of the UK grading system is difficult. Students seeking "Computer Science Assignment Help UK" must find experts familiar with specific British coding conventions and regional university standards to remain competitive.
Getting affordable assistance at Computer Science Help UK
Selecting an ideal service at a budget-friendly rate is often a significant challenge for students. While searching for affordable computer science assignment help in the UK, you likely encounter numerous online options. If you find yourself overwhelmed, simply searching for "MyAssignmentHelp" provides a direct path to a more manageable academic experience.
Unlike many competitors who offer quality services at premium prices or low-cost providers that sacrifice technical accuracy, MyAssignmentHelp bridges the gap between value and excellence. We employ a team of highly qualified experts, ensuring your project is handled by a specialized computer science solver dedicated to securing top grades. Furthermore, our complete package includes several essential free features:
- Free Plagiarism Reports: Ensuring 100% original logic and code.
- Unlimited Revisions: Guaranteeing the final product meets your expectations.
- Editing & Proofreading: Refining technical reports for maximum clarity.
- Citations and Formatting: Professional handling of IEEE, Harvard, or APA standards.
Our transparent pricing model is supported by a fully encrypted payment system, ensuring your data remains secure. We understand the rigour of UK academic standards and the pressure of strict deadlines; therefore, our team works diligently to provide high-quality, comprehensive solutions under one roof. Regardless of the complexity or timeframe, you can access hassle-free results and take advantage of seasonal discounts to boost your academic performance.
How to manage a perfect referencing style standard to handle computer science assignments help online?
In the UK, academic integrity is paramount, and mastering the nuances of citation is a core requirement for any high-scoring assignment in computer science. Depending on your specific university and the technical nature of your project—whether it is a complex coding report or a theoretical exploration of artificial intelligence—you will be required to follow a specific style. Navigating these requirements can be challenging, which is why many students seek computer science assignment help online to ensure their citations meet the rigorous standards of institutions like York, Sheffield, or Imperial College London.
IEEE (Institute of Electrical and Electronics Engineers)
The IEEE style is widely considered the "gold standard" for technical and engineering-focused papers. It is a numeric system designed for efficiency, ensuring that dense technical documents remain readable without long parenthetical interruptions.
In-Text Citation: Sources are indicated by numbers in square brackets, such as [1] or [2], which correspond to the full citation in your bibliography.
Reference List: Entries are arranged numerically in the order they first appear in the text, rather than alphabetically.
Example: "As discussed in [1], the efficiency of the algorithm increases significantly when utilizing parallel processing."
Harvard (Cite Them Right)
As the most widely used style in UK academia, Harvard is an author-date system. It is particularly effective for theoretical essays where the recency and the specific researcher’s name are central to the argument. Our Free Harvard Citation Generator makes your work easy. It helps to give accurate results that craft high-quality Computer Science assignments.
In-Text Citation: This uses the author’s surname and the year of publication, for example, (Smith, 2024).
Reference List: Sources are arranged alphabetically by the author’s surname at the end of the document.
Example: "The global shift toward green computing is essential for long-term digital sustainability (Brown, 2024)."
Other Specialized Styles
While IEEE and Harvard dominate, you may encounter other specialized formats in specific sub-disciplines. ACM (Association for Computing Machinery) is often preferred for Human-Computer Interaction (HCI) projects, while APA (American Psychological Association) is the standard for assignments crossing into social sciences, such as "Digital Ethics."
Securing professional computer science assignment help online ensures that these styles are applied with 100% accuracy, preventing avoidable mark deductions. Whether you need a detailed bibliography or assistance with formatting complex code references, a dedicated professional can provide the technical precision required for a world-class assignment.
Sample questions on Computer Science Assignment Help
Here are some sample questions that are related to the assignment for computer science. Computer Science Homework Helpers share the model solutions with students regarding theories used in computer science. These answers get an A+ grade in their exam, and you definitely get knowledge on this question and its answers.
Question: What is graph theory in Computer Science, and how does it apply to real-world issues?
Model solution
Graph theory is a fundamental field of mathematics and computer science that studies graphs, which are mathematical structures used to model relationships between objects. Unlike a standard bar or line chart, a graph in this context consists of two primary elements:
Vertices (Nodes): These represent individual entities, such as computers, cities, or people.
Edges (Links): these are the lines that connect vertices, representing a specific relationship or interaction between them.
Technical Applications in Computer Science
In the digital landscape, graph theory serves as the architectural foundation for many critical technologies and algorithms.
1. Network Topology and Routing
The Internet is essentially a massive graph where each IP address is a node, and each connection is an edge. Graph algorithms are used to determine the most efficient path for data packets to travel across routers, ensuring minimal latency and preventing network congestion.
2. Search Engine Optimization
Search engines like Google utilize graph theory to determine the relevance of webpages. Through the PageRank algorithm, the web is viewed as a directed graph where pages are nodes and hyperlinks are edges. The importance of a page is calculated based on the number and quality of edges (links) pointing toward it.
3. Database Management (Graph Databases)
Traditional relational databases use tables, but graph databases like Neo4j use graph structures. These are highly effective for managing data with complex relationships, such as recommendation engines or fraud detection systems, where the connections between data points are as important as the data itself.
Real-World Problem Solving
Beyond theoretical computer science, graph theory provides practical solutions to logistical, biological, and physical challenges.
Navigation and Pathfinding
Global Positioning Systems (GPS) rely on graph-based algorithms like Dijkstra’s Algorithm or A* to provide directions. The map is treated as a weighted graph where edges (roads) have values based on distance, speed limits, or real-time traffic data. The algorithm identifies the "shortest path" between the starting node and the destination node.
Logistics and Supply Chain
Large-scale delivery companies use graph theory to optimize their supply chains. By solving the Travelling Salesperson Problem (TSP), businesses can determine the most efficient route for a vehicle to visit multiple locations and return to the starting point, significantly reducing fuel costs and delivery times.
Social Network Analysis
Social media platforms model user interactions as a social graph. By analyzing the density of edges between certain nodes, these platforms can identify communities, suggest new connections, and track the viral spread of information or trends across the network.
Academic Support for Technical Subjects at MyassignmentHelp
Graph theory is a mathematically rigorous subject that requires a strong grasp of both logic and programming. Students often find it beneficial to hire experts for computer science homework online to better understand the nuances of graph traversals and optimization. Utilizing a professional computer science homework helper can provide clarity on complex topics like spanning trees or bipartite graphs.
For those managing heavy course loads, seeking online computer science assignment help ensures that projects meet technical standards. Furthermore, because the subject is rooted in discrete mathematics, Math assignment help assistance can be a valuable resource for mastering the underlying proofs and formulas required for advanced study.
Why are we, the team at MyAssignmentHelp, the best choice for UK students?
MyAssignmentHelp provides a comprehensive support system designed to address the specific academic pressures of the British higher education landscape. By acting as a dedicated computer science solver, the platform bridges the gap between complex theoretical concepts and the high-level practical execution required by top-tier UK universities.
Tailored Technical Assistance
The primary challenge for many students is the move from basic coding to advanced software architecture. When students decide to do my computer science homework for me through our service, they gain access to experts who specialize in localized British coding conventions. This includes:
● Rigorous Code Quality: Ensuring all scripts adhere to clean code principles and specific university style guides. For those working with system-level applications, our C++ assignment help ensures memory safety and performance optimization
● Mathematical Foundations: Providing deep-dive support for discrete mathematics, set theory, and complexity analysis (Big O).
● Documentation Excellence: Crafting the extensive technical reports and reflective logs that often constitute a major portion of the UK grading rubric.
Strategic Academic Support
Navigating the transition from theory to application is a common hurdle. Our online computer science assignment help is structured to provide more than just answers; it provides a roadmap for understanding.
| Service Feature |
Student Benefit |
| Plagiarism-Free Logic |
Every algorithm is built from scratch to bypass strict MOSS and Turnitin checks. |
| Referencing Mastery |
Accurate application of IEEE and Harvard referencing standards. |
| Environment Sync |
Ensuring code is compatible with specific university compilers and server environments. |
By focusing on the "why" behind the logic, MyAssignmentHelp empowers students to defend their work during viva and technical interviews. This holistic approach ensures that when you seek computer science homework assistance, you aren't just completing a task—you are mastering the discipline according to the highest global standards.